Responsibilities
  • Tap furnaces as directed by the supervisor.
  • Set up and operate the furnace for melting.
  • Load and unload materials.
  • Clean the furnace and equipment.
  • Count, weigh, and record the number of units of materials moved on the daily production sheet.
  • Remove material samples, label them with identifying information, and take the samples for laboratory analysis.
  • Operate an industrial truck or electrical hoist to assist in loading or moving materials and product.
  • Skim sows and ingots while ensuring products meet or exceed quality standards.
  • Stack, band, and prepare product for shipping.
  • Diagnose, troubleshoot, and repair furnaces.
